I'm doing a status run on Thursday from HBA - MEL - SYD - OOL
At MEL my partner wants to give me a bag to check in for the rest of the journey as she will be visiting me up on the Gold Coast for 2 weeks soon after and flying up with Jetstar. I was wondering whether checking in a bag was allowed halfway through a journey as it would mean we won't have to fork out baggage charges for her bags on Jetstar a few days later.
I will be flying in J if that makes any difference.

You will have no issues what so ever checking luggage partway through a journey as long as you are within your allowance.

Class of travel does not matter.
